新聞中心
Mojs 是一個(gè)輕量級(jí)的 JavaScript 動(dòng)畫(huà)庫(kù),它提供了一種簡(jiǎn)單而直觀的方式來(lái)創(chuàng)建各種動(dòng)畫(huà)效果,在 Mojs 中,形狀模塊是一個(gè)重要的組成部分,它允許我們輕松地對(duì)各種形狀進(jìn)行動(dòng)畫(huà)處理,本文將詳細(xì)介紹 Mojs 的形狀模塊及其使用方法。

在沈北新等地區(qū),都構(gòu)建了全面的區(qū)域性戰(zhàn)略布局,加強(qiáng)發(fā)展的系統(tǒng)性、市場(chǎng)前瞻性、產(chǎn)品創(chuàng)新能力,以專(zhuān)注、極致的服務(wù)理念,為客戶(hù)提供網(wǎng)站建設(shè)、成都網(wǎng)站制作 網(wǎng)站設(shè)計(jì)制作按需定制開(kāi)發(fā),公司網(wǎng)站建設(shè),企業(yè)網(wǎng)站建設(shè),品牌網(wǎng)站設(shè)計(jì),營(yíng)銷(xiāo)型網(wǎng)站,成都外貿(mào)網(wǎng)站制作,沈北新網(wǎng)站建設(shè)費(fèi)用合理。
我們需要引入 Mojs 庫(kù),可以通過(guò)以下方式在 HTML 文件中引入:
接下來(lái),我們將創(chuàng)建一個(gè) HTML 元素,用于展示我們的動(dòng)畫(huà)效果,我們可以創(chuàng)建一個(gè)矩形:
現(xiàn)在我們已經(jīng)準(zhǔn)備好開(kāi)始使用 Mojs 的形狀模塊了,我們需要獲取到我們剛剛創(chuàng)建的矩形元素:
const rect = document.getElementById('rect');
接下來(lái),我們將使用 Mojs 的形狀模塊來(lái)創(chuàng)建一個(gè)形狀實(shí)例,在這個(gè)例子中,我們將創(chuàng)建一個(gè)矩形形狀:
import { Rect } from 'mojs';
const shape = new Rect({
el: rect,
x: 0,
y: 0,
w: 100,
h: 100,
});
現(xiàn)在我們已經(jīng)創(chuàng)建了一個(gè)矩形形狀實(shí)例,我們可以開(kāi)始對(duì)它進(jìn)行動(dòng)畫(huà)處理,以下是一些常用的動(dòng)畫(huà)方法:
1、x() 和 y():這兩個(gè)方法分別用于設(shè)置形狀的水平位置和垂直位置,我們可以將矩形移動(dòng)到屏幕的中心:
shape.x(window.innerWidth / 2); shape.y(window.innerHeight / 2);
2、w() 和 h():這兩個(gè)方法分別用于設(shè)置形狀的寬度和高度,我們可以將矩形的寬度和高度都擴(kuò)大兩倍:
shape.w(200); shape.h(200);
3、rotate():這個(gè)方法用于設(shè)置形狀的旋轉(zhuǎn)角度,我們可以將矩形旋轉(zhuǎn) 45 度:
shape.rotate(45);
4、scale():這個(gè)方法用于設(shè)置形狀的縮放比例,我們可以將矩形放大兩倍:
shape.scale(2);
5、opacity():這個(gè)方法用于設(shè)置形狀的透明度,我們可以將矩形設(shè)置為半透明:
shape.opacity(0.5);
6、attr():這個(gè)方法用于設(shè)置形狀的屬性,我們可以將矩形的背景顏色更改為藍(lán)色:
shape.attr({
fill: 'blue',
});
以上就是 Mojs 形狀模塊的基本使用方法,通過(guò)這些方法,我們可以輕松地對(duì)各種形狀進(jìn)行動(dòng)畫(huà)處理,希望本文對(duì)你有所幫助,祝你在使用 Mojs 時(shí)愉快!
網(wǎng)頁(yè)題目:從Mojs動(dòng)畫(huà)庫(kù)開(kāi)始:探索形狀模塊
路徑分享:http://fisionsoft.com.cn/article/dhspeco.html


咨詢(xún)
建站咨詢(xún)
